Hello, my name is Paul Magriel, and my goal is to publish a series of books and articles based on my research in the game of backgammon.

For over 40 years, I have been playing, teaching and studying backgammon.

As a competitive player I have won more major tournaments including the World Championship, than any other player. I am one of the original inductees into the Backgammon Hall of Fame.

 Winning the World Challenge Cup in Athens 1977

In 1976 I wrote the definitive book of the game, "Backgammon". It is still considered the Bible of backgammon literature and has remained the standard text for generations of students.  I also wrote a highly acclaimed weekly column for the New York Times from 1979-1981.




In the 1970's, 80's and early 90's, I was a highly publicized and active tournament player. I was featured in magazines such as Sports Illustrated and Esquire. I have enjoyed numerous television appearances including such as an exclusive interview with Dan Rather on 60 Minutes.

RESEARCH and TEACHING

Although less active competitively my quest to explore and understand this great game has never ended.

I have made conceptual breakthroughs in several areas. As a by-product of my continued teaching and lecturing I have developed new ways to explain the game - making this knowledge accessible to the average player.

                                     Lecturing in Boston


My research has covered a variety of topics:

1.) Middle game concepts such as priming, tempo play, blitzing, containment, natural checker configuration, control of outfield, new ways to pinpoint your best game plan (run, attack, prime or holding game).

2.) Tactics such as Circle Back, Trap Play, advanced little known forms of Duplication, NGA (number good anyway). Ways to create anti-jokers for opponents and many, many more.

3.) Doubling theory

4.) Reference positions for winning and gammon chances in bear-off. Winning probabilities and cube action in several types of holding games. Some prime vs. prime standard reference positions. All presented in user-friendly fashion.

5.) Encyclopedia of Openings - presented in new formats

6.) And many other fascinating topics!

All this work has resulted in a wealth of material:  thousands of position cards, hundreds of pages of written notes and outlines for dozens of books.
